Breaking Through the Noise


How a Former Lyft Driver Became the Last Stop for Women Seeking Real Healing

It started, like many pivotal life changes, with a whisper, and then a thump.

One moment, Victoria Shakur was driving her Lyft route through quiet streets, politely making conversation with her passengers. The next, she found herself mid-ride with tears rolling down the cheeks of yet another stranger, sharing their deepest, most painful stories. Trauma. Loneliness. Childhood pain. This wasn’t unusual for her; in fact, it had been happening for years. But on that day, something shifted. A male passenger, unusually open and raw, looked her dead in the eye and said, “You’ve told me more in this short ride than my therapist has in two years. I should be paying you.”

As he closed the car door behind him, she felt something literal and metaphysical. A tap on her head, a deep pressure in her gut, and a voice from somewhere inside that said, clearly and unmistakably: This is it.

That moment birthed what is now U Mastery LLC, a coaching business rooted not in surface-level motivation or trendy self-help, but in deep transformation. Victoria Shakur didn’t just create another coaching company. She built a lifeline for high-achieving women who are silently suffering behind their polished exteriors.

From the Backseat to Center Stage

Victoria didn’t start with a dream of being a life coach. Her journey was more spiritual nudge than strategic blueprint. After leaving corporate America, she turned to driving Lyft for the freedom it offered. But her passengers, mostly women, kept pouring their hearts out to her.

“I didn’t know it at the time, but I was coaching people without even realizing it,” she said.

It took a prayer, or rather, a conversation with what she calls “Source,” to open her eyes. She asked for a sign that this was her calling, something undeniable. And she got it.

What followed felt like divine choreography. She woke up one night at 2 a.m. with the name “U Mastery” in her mind, along with the colors and brand visuals. Everything flowed. Everything clicked. And behind it all was a woman on a mission to guide one percent of the world’s female population through emotional freedom and personal transformation.

Healing Beyond the Hustle

Victoria’s approach is not typical. She doesn’t work from the assumption that her clients are broken or in need of fixing.

“I’m a rebel in the self-help industry,” she said, unapologetically. “I don’t believe you’re broken. I believe you’ve been conditioned to forget who you are.”

Her clients are high-achieving women, CEOs, solopreneurs, executives, who look impeccable on the outside but carry a weight of emotional burdens on the inside. They come to her exhausted, stressed, burned out, and confused by recurring patterns in their relationships, careers, or personal well-being.

“They think success means working 10 or 11 hours a day, grinding until they collapse,” she explained. “But once they fall in love with themselves, truly love themselves, all of that fades away. They become magnetic. Life starts working with them.”

That magnetism, she says, is their feminine power awakening. For many, it’s the first time they’ve experienced success without struggle, joy without guilt, or love without conditions.

Not Just Coaching, Soul Alignment

U Mastery LLC is a mind and body coaching practice designed to help women detach from past trauma, get more done with less stress, and expand their capacity to hold success emotionally, mentally, and spiritually.

Victoria’s methodology blends intuitive questioning, emotional intelligence, and spiritual guidance. She doesn’t just address symptoms; she addresses identity. For her, recurring struggles in love, money, or health are not coincidences. They are clues.

“If someone keeps attracting the same kind of partner, or feels like success keeps slipping through their fingers, that’s not bad luck,” she said. “That’s unresolved identity playing out. It’s negative programming running on autopilot.”

With each client, she helps peel back layers of false identity, programming from childhood, past relationships, or cultural norms, and replaces it with alignment to their true desires and self-worth.
